Betting in Indiana casinos is quite favorite and there are a number of riverboat gambling establishments in the state, where the minimum age for betting is twenty-one. A number of of the casinos are open from 11 a.m. to 12 Midnight, 7 days a week, and others stay open for twenty four hours. Indiana gambling establishments provide a variety of table games, such as chemin de fer, roulette, craps, and several kinds of poker, such as Double-hand, Draw, Stud, Let It Ride, and 3 Card, as properly as consistent poker tournaments.

The majority of the larger Indiana casinos are open for twenty four hours, like Caesars Indiana, in Elizabeth, with ninety-three thousand sqft. of gaming area, two, 349 slot games, 120 table games, including poker, black-jack, craps, roulette, and baccarat, ten restaurants, and a hotel. Another big Indiana casino, the Argosy Casino and Hotel, in Lawrenceburg, is available twenty-four hours and has 74,300 sqft., a couple of,three hundred and eighty four slot machines, eighty seven table games, and 5 restaurants. In addition, the Resorts East Chicago Hotel and Gambling establishment has fifty three thousand sqft.,one thousand nine hundred and sixty six slot machines, and fifty table games.

There are numerous smaller Indiana betting houses, as properly, which include the Majestic Star in Gary, also open 24 hours, with forty three thousand square feet, 1,600 slt machine games, and 47 table games, and the Horseshoe Casino, in Hammond, with forty two thousand five hundred and seventy three sqft., 2 thousand slots, forty nine table games, numerous bars, and restaurants. Yet another common Indiana gambling establishment is the Grand Victoria Casino and Resort, in Rising Sun, available Monday via Thursday, from 8 a.m. to 5:00 a.m., and Friday through Sunday, available for twenty-four hours. This forty thousand square foot gambling establishment has 1,497 slot games, 36 table games, and four eateries.

Indiana casinos bring a large amount of cash to the state and the enthusiasm for wagering in Indiana is widespread. It’s estimated that Indiana gambling establishments in Northwest Indiana ranked 3rd in the gambling market of the U.S..
